Seabury came tearing into Saturday's matchup with eight straight wins , and they left with even more momentum. They were the clear victors by a 3-0 margin over the Molokai Farmers. That's the second time they've managed to beat them this season, as they also won 3-1 on Friday.
Seabury's win bumped their record up to 10-2. As for Molokai, they have been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 7-6 record this season.
